Éric Chahi is a French computer game designer best known as the creator of Another World (known as Out of This World in the United States).

Another World
Another World, known as Out of This World in North America, is a 1991 cinematic platformer designed and developed by Eric Chahi. The graphics and box art were designed by Chahi, while the music was composed by Jean-François Freitas.
